Improve your allergies by training your immune system


An allergic reaction is your body’s immune response to a substance that it considers dangerous. Your immune system identifies a foreign substance and produces antibodies against it. These antibodies give you your typical allergy symptoms: a runny nose, itchy or watery eyes, sneezing, or itchy skin. With allergy shots, your immune system is gradually exposed to a known allergen. This builds up an immunity to it. Each of your allergy shots will contain a small amount of your allergy trigger, such as mold, dust, pollen, or pet dander. As the dose increases, your tolerance to the substance increases as well.

How often will I need to get shots?

At SFENTA, our allergists in West Palm Beach customize all treatment plans, with the use of individual allergy testing, to achieve the best possible outcome for you. Your treatment plan will depend on your individual circumstances and needs. Most likely, you will begin your treatment with one or two shots per week. Each shot will contain enough of the allergy trigger to stimulate an immune response, but not enough to cause a full-blown allergic reaction. This amount will gradually be increased until you reach the maximum dosage, also referred to as the maintenance dose. At this point, the frequency of your shots will decrease until you are getting about one shot per month.

What are the benefits?

Rather than just suppressing your symptoms, allergy shots address the cause of your allergies. As your immune system learns to tolerate the allergen, the necessity to avoid your triggers vanishes, and you can enjoy more freedom in your daily life.

Other benefits include:

  • Allergy shots can treat multiple allergies at the same time.
  • Decrease your reliance on oral medications.
  • Results are long-term.
  • Effective for a variety of allergies, including pollen, dust, insect venom, and pet dander.
  • May also improve asthma symptoms and inflammatory skin conditions such as eczema.
